Rhinestone Me Here I strut of colourless glass against the restlessness of menagerie, wild in a cage of cheap knock-offs waiting for my diamond dreams. The yearn is deep to twist 'round the fingers of filigree to drape across the neck of silken skin of beautiful, flawless, and priceless affection, yet, I am none of these, as I am only an ornamental overdose of artificial glitz slowly fading my lustre for a moment to shine in the sun. How tragic to live by the maker's decree unwilling of inanimate weep, though here I masquerade of pasted collage with my simulated sparkle and hollow facets, a mime of gems and fools, lest they see my pain in their reflection. So it goes that I am worthless worn by dozens of lifeless entities in pretend pose of something more though being less merely placed to decorate that empty space that is I, an imitation of life. By Melissa P. Monette |
